Recherche script de grid tres performant

Recherche script de grid tres performant - PHP - Programmation

Marsh Posté le 18-07-2014 à 10:49:49    

Bonjour,
 
Pour un projet perso je cherche un système de grid très performant étant capable de gérer des millions de lignes.
Je sais qu'il y a des beaux plugins de grid en jquery mais ça me fait un peu peur niveau performance. Je prefererais un système pur php.
Ceci dit je pense qu'on est bien obligé de passer par du javascript pour ajouter / supprimer des lignes non ?
 
Quelles sont les solutions de grid utilisant php/mysql les plus performantes actuellement ? (gratuites ou payantes)

Reply

Marsh Posté le 18-07-2014 à 10:49:49   

Reply

Marsh Posté le 18-07-2014 à 12:14:03    

Tu veux dire un générateur de quadrillage ?


---------------
Viens jouer aux Rébus sur HFR
Reply

Marsh Posté le 18-07-2014 à 14:43:48    

Je pense qu'il parle d'un composant de type tableau paginé/triable qui affiche des enregistrements d'une BD.
 
Quand il a parlé de grid, au début, j'ai cru qu'il parlais de calcul sur une architecture en machines en réseau. Du coup, je me suis dit : purée, faire du grid en PHP ou JS, c'est pas gagné pour avoir des perfs :/


---------------
Astres, outil de help-desk GPL : http://sourceforge.net/projects/astres, ICARE, gestion de conf : http://sourceforge.net/projects/icare, Outil Planeta Calandreta : https://framalibre.org/content/planeta-calandreta
Reply

Marsh Posté le 19-07-2014 à 00:11:33    

et tous les navigateurs exploseront si tu depasse les quelques milliers de lignes
 
Donc soit tu charges les données côté client en json  ( mais plusieurs Mo ca va piquer )  soit ut fait de la pagination/filtres /tri en PHP


---------------

Reply

Marsh Posté le 19-07-2014 à 03:18:06    

Oui bien vu.
De toute manière ce n'est pas intéressant d'avoir trop de données à l’écran.
 
Je vais donc mettre en place un moteur de recherche et limiter les lignes à quelques centaines.
 
Je précise un peu la démarche :
1) On saisit des critères de recherches
2) La grid renvoie des résultats (limit 100)
3) On ouvre un écran de detail en cliquant sur une ligne.
 
Le but est d’accéder aux détails d'une ligne
 
Voila une image du script phpgrid qui correspond :
http://phpgrid.com/wp-content/uploads/2012/04/phpGrid_WYSIWYG.png
 
Le principe est simple, après la contrainte est le nombre de données (5 millions) dans la table principale. Donc il me faut surtout un moteur de recherche tip top.
 
Le script phpgrid a l'air bien, quelqu'un a deja essayé ?


Message édité par tithus le 19-07-2014 à 03:20:28
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ed